tcp服务器和tcp客户端的区别?tcp服务器需要绑定ip么

tcp服务器和tcp客户端的区别?

成都创新互联公司主要从事做网站、网站制作、网页设计、企业做网站、公司建网站等业务。立足成都服务沅江,十年网站建设经验,价格优惠、服务专业,欢迎来电咨询建站服务:13518219792

1. 监听和连接不同:TCP服务器负责监听并等待客户端连接,而TCP客户端负责主动发起连接请求。

2. 数据传输不同:TCP服务器通常需要处理同时来自多个客户端的数据传输请求,并确保数据按顺序传输。而TCP客户端只需要发送数据给服务器,然后等待服务器的响应。

3. 端口号不同:TCP服务器通常绑定特定的端口号,用于接收来自客户端的连接请求。而TCP客户端在连接时并不需要绑定特定的端口号。

4. 处理连接不同:TCP服务器负责开启和关闭连接,管理连接的生命周期,并进行一些异常情况的处理。而TCP客户端只需要建立和断开连接,并在连接期间发送和接收数据。

5. 服务范围不同:TCP服务器通常提供可响应多客户端同时请求的服务,可以为多个客户端提供服务。而TCP客户端只服务于单个服务器。

c++怎么编写modbustcp?

要编写Modbus TCP协议,你可以使用C语言编写一个TCP服务器程序。首先,你需要创建一个TCP套接字并绑定到指定的IP地址和端口。

然后,你可以使用Modbus协议规范来解析和处理客户端发送的请求。根据请求的功能码,你可以执行相应的操作,如读取或写入寄存器。

最后,你需要将响应数据发送回客户端。你可以使用C语言的网络编程库,如socket和netinet来实现这些功能。确保在编写代码时遵循Modbus协议规范,并进行适当的错误处理和异常处理。

服务器无法与 \Device\NetBT_Tcpip_{CD97CE5B-B990-433C-BEAB-6A3CC503EB05} 传输绑定,因为网络上的另一?

用了vpn后就和其他用vpn的电脑在同个局域网了,你的电脑名称和其他的电脑可能相同所以出现这个问题。解决:尝试把计算机名改一下方法:我的电脑-属性--电脑名称--更改

tcp协议能看到端口吗?

可以

关于TCP协议中端口从以下三个方面来谈。

一、端口号范围:1~65535

二、端口的概念:

端口(Port)大致有两种意思:

1,是物理意义上的端口,比如,ADSL Modem、集线器、交换机、路由器用于连接其他网络设备的接口,如RJ-45端口、SC端口等等。

2,是逻辑意义上的端口,一般是指TCP/IP协议中的端口,端口号的范围从0到65535,比如用于浏览网页服务的80端口,用于FTP服务的21端口等等。

以逻辑意义上的端口为例。

三、分类情况:

1,公认端口

文章标题:tcp服务器和tcp客户端的区别?tcp服务器需要绑定ip么
文章起源:http://www.mswzjz.com/qtweb/news10/183460.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联